Dem delegate in McCain ad kicked out of DNCC
Timesunion ^ | 8-25-08 | Irene Jay Liu

Posted on 08/25/2008 11:38:57 AM PDT by NavyCanDo

The Democratic convention delegate and Clinton supporter who appears in the latest McCain ad saying she’ll vote for the Republican, Debra Bartoshevich, has been kicked out of the convention.

Debra Bartoshevich is persona non grata at the Democratic National Convention in Denver, now that the former delegate from Wisconsin is the star of an ad in which she proclaims her support for presumptive Republican nominee John McCain.

In the TV ad, sponsored by the McCain campaign, Bartoshevich explains that while she was a “proud Hillary Clinton Democrat,” she is unhappy that Democrats are putting Sen. Barack Obama at the top of their ticket.

Bartoshevich says she is preparing to vote for a Republican for the “first” time because she respects McCain’s “maverick and independent streak.”

The ad concludes with Bartoshevich saying that with Clinton out of the race, “now (McCain is) the one with the experience and judgment.”

“A lot of Democrats will vote McCain,” Bartoshevich says at the end of the advertisement. “It’s okay — really.”

Bartoshevich’s move has led to her ouster as one of Wisconsin’s delegates at the Democratic National Convention. But maybe she’ll find friends at a “Happy Hour for Hillary” in downtown Denver tonight.

The reception is being hosted by the Republican National Committee tonight, just a few blocks from the Democratic National Convention.
